Currently over 13,000 people self build their own homes in the UK each year. This allows them total control of what goes into that home and therefore is the perfect time to add a WiFi or Ethernet network which will future proof that home for the ever increasing amount of data we need.
When you are building your own home planning is the key and this extends to planning your network. Listing the items that need data and if they accept a wired or a wireless connection, or both is key to understanding how much and where you need to run wires.
When we initially think of a network it might look simple but in reality the modern home needs more and more connections and almost any device can now be "smart" to some extent.
This list is not exhaustive and could already be well over 100 items that need access to the internet and each other in today's modern home.
Now we have a list of what we are going to connect and where these items will live in the home we can start to decide what we need to install to give us those connections.
The internet that comes into your home needs to be split up and shared around all the devices that need it and to do this we use a switch. The internet comes into your house and into your internet router, this then feeds a switch which we're going to use to send data all around your house.
The ideal time to install a network is along with the electrical first fix. This is the best time to hide all the wires internally under plaster work just like hiding electrical cables.
